Repoker of stars for the Davis Cup: Djokovic, Sinner, De Miñaur, Norrie and Auger-Aliassime

Malaga will be able to enjoy another year of the Final Phase of the Davis Cup, the most prestigious national team tournament in the world of tennis.. Regardless of what happens these days in Turin, in the ATP Finals, the eight captains of the qualified teams have already published the lists of their respective teams, in which the figures of Djokovic for Serbia; Sinner with Italy; De Minaur with the Australian team; Norrie, the player from the United Kingdom, and Auger Aliassime, current Davis champion with Canada.

Spain will not be able to enjoy the show and the warmth offered by the Malaga fans after losing to Serbia on September 15. Despite not having Alcaraz’s right hand or Nadal’s left hand, this is a review of the big names that the capital of the Costa del Sol will receive between November 21 and 26.

Novak Djokovic

Novak Djokovicthe most outstanding tennis player of the Serbian national team, He arrives at the tournament as number one in the ATP ranking. Not only is he at the top of the rankings, but he also comes from celebrating his 40th Masters title on November 5. Despite the quality of the Serbian tennis player, Djokovic and his team will seek to redeem themselves after his performance in the last Davis Cup, where they failed to advance to the quarterfinals.

Recognized as one of the best tennis players in historyAt 36 years old, he has 97 titles under his belt and holds the record for the most Grand Slam titles in the history of tennis, with 24, surpassing prominent players such as Nadal and Murray. His career also includes six wins at the ATP Finals (it could be 7 this coming weekend in Turin), an achievement shared with Federer, and the lead in M1000 tournament wins.

Jannik Sinner

Italy’s star is Jannik Sinner, fourth in the ATP rankings. The Italians will seek revenge with the young right-hander after losing in the semifinals against Canada in the 2022 Davis Cup. Sinner’s objective for 2023 is clear, to bring the Davis Cup to his land. The Italian arrives at Carpena after establishing himself as the Italian tennis player with the most ATP titles, after winning his tenth trophy in Vienna.

At just 22 years old, he is already a ten-time winner of an ATP individual championship. In 2020 he achieved the achievement of being the youngest tennis player to reach the quarterfinals of a Roland Garros, record that Djokovic previously had.

Alex de Miñaur

Australia’s great hope to become champion in Malaga is called Alex De Miñaur. The Australians were already runners-up in the Carpena last year and in 2023 they want to take another step, and to do so they will need the best version of the 12th ranked ATP. De Minaur will have the support of Max Purcell, number 45 in the ATP rankings, the second Australian sword.

De Miñaur is Australian but with a Spanish mother and a sporting birth in Alicante, since he started playing there when he was 5 years old. The Sydney-born player has already won seven ATP titles in his career and was introduced to the world of tennis in 2019 as another young promise after winning his first major tournament at the Huafa Properties Zhuhai Championships.. He is 24 years old and is already considered one of the favorites for any tournament in which he participates.

Cameron Norrie

Cameron Norrie is the star of a team that also includes Andy Murray. Norrie is currently 18th in the ATP rankings. The British reach the final draw after not qualifying in 2022. Due to the disaster of the previous year, the goal in 2023 is to make amends and show everyone that the United Kingdom is the best team of the moment.

At 28 years old, Norrie has a record of five ATP titles, he achieved the first in the 2021 Los Cabos tournament and the last in Rio on February 26 against Carlos Alcaraz in the final. The one born in Johannesburg is betting everything for this Davis, since he decided not to participate in the Paris Masters1000 to arrive with the greatest possible strength for his matches at the Carpena.

Canadathe current Davis Cup champion, returns to the Costa del Sol city to revalidate his title with a name as his flag: Felix Auger-Aliassime. The future and present of world tennis passes through the 23-year-old young man born in Montreal. The Canadian team is in a worse position compared to the previous tournament in Malaga, since all its tennis players selected for the tournament have suffered a drop in the ranking.

The Montrealer has five ATP titles under his belt. 2022 was a great year for him, since four of the five titles he owns were achieved in that year, in addition to the Davis Cup. He won his last title in Basel, thus revalidating last year’s title. Auger-Aliassime is the best ranked player in his country’s ATP, ranking 29th, a significant drop from the previous year when he was in sixth place.

Andy Murray, another illustrious name for the Carpena event

The United Kingdom had the opportunity to have a tennis legend and they did not waste it. The second sword of the British team in this Davis Cup will be Andy Murray, number 42 in the ATP ranking and who was number one in 2016. The 36-year-old Scot wants to put the finishing touch to the end of his career and win his first Davis Cup on November 26 at the Carpena.

Murray is considered one of the best tennis players of modern times, having won 46 ATP titles and three Grand Slam titles: The US Open in 2012 and two Wimbledons in 2013 and 2016. He is the second British tennis player with the most titles in this category in historyHe also has two Olympic gold medals. Murray’s “curse” was to coincide in the era of Djokovic, Nadal and Federer, since the 16 of the 21 finals that he lost in his career were against one of the three.
